Today I would like to talk about tensura more precisely the Web Novel. I would like some changes to be made to Rimuru's and Yuuki's abilities and stats. I'll start with abilities first. I would like to add immortality negation to Rimuru and Yuuki thanks to Beelzebub and Void God Azatoth. Indeed it has been said that when an object is absorbed it can be stored or destroyed. I then propose that Rimuru can obtain the negation of all types of immortality he possesses. To justify a little I will take the example of type 8 because Rimuru is able to kill demons permanently and spiritual beings.
For statistics I will only mention the case of Rimuru including Stricking Strength, Durability and Speed.
For Stricking Strength and Durability I will group together in one piece. For me the Durability of Rimuru evolves according to his AP what I mean is that his Durability should be modified by adding Univers+ and probably Multiversal+ because I analyzed that Rimutu can only absorb objects at his level what I want say is that its Durability depends on its AP. By taking from the base to solidify my remarks, I will take as a basis the definition of skill. A skill has been said to be part of the soul of its user. So Beelzebub and void God Azatoth who can absorb a space-time continuum would therefore put Rimuru's durability at Universe+ because his soul is at the same level. With void God Azatoth Rimuru could destroy infinite space-time continuum so he should have equivalent Durability and same for Stricking Strength since Rimuru should be of that level. To further strengthen I will take the Rimuru fight against Veldora and Velgrynd. Rimuru tried to absorb Veldora and being weaker than him which ended in failure at this level because he felt pain directly on his soul so to be able to absorb it he evolved into a true dragon to have a level equivalent which should confirm the reasoning.
For Rimuru's Speed I'll take the ending and some already well-known concepts.
The great spirit of time is the source of time itself which means it should have infinite speed.
Veldanava who transcends him should therefore have an Immeasurable speed especially since he existed in the void where there was neither space nor time and he could move there which means that the formula v = d/t is not not applicable, which reflects the Immeasurable speed.
Rimuru > Veldanava which means that Rimuru should have a speed comparable to or greater than that of Veldanava. To support the reflection I will say that when Rimuru was sent to the end of space and time he was in the original world and he could move and move there. Ciel also said that Rimuru could reach any place only with his will. Some will say that to go back in time he used Time Wrap to teleport or go back in time, which is not correct because for it has been explained that Time Wrap did not allow you to teleport but to move because This was set up by a other world who wanted to return to her world but teleportation does not allow it because it is impossible to cross dimensions by teleporting. To further justify that he did not teleport, I will go into the principle of teleportation spells. To teleport to a place it must exist first but in the world where Rimuru was nothing there was no teleportation. Now in the case of time travel, time would first have to exist to be able to navigate it but again in this world there was nothing so time travel is irrelevant. The only possible option is therefore to move , which is a feat for the Immeasurable speed.
